Q:It says 4 in. but is that ID or OD? Will this fit through a 4-in. hole in concrete?
by|Aug 2, 2022
1 Answer
Answer This Question
A: Outside diameter. The piping is very thin aluminum so you can squeeze and shift as needed to get through the opening, as long as you don't pop the seam and have to take it out and try again. Ive put two of these in my home, one as a bath exhaust vent and one as a dryer vent. Both work well, though they clap a small amount in very stong winds.
